1910. Pownal, Vermont. At 12, Grace and her best friend Arthur must leave school and go to work as a ¿doffers¿ on their mothers¿ looms in the mill. Grace¿s mother is the best worker, fast and powerful, and Grace desperately wants to help her. But she¿s left handed and doffing is a right-handed job.
